Jail my son until the day I’ll die, mother begs court

A mother has pleaded with Eldoret Senior Resident Magistrate Christine Menya to jail her abusive son until the day she will die.

The mother, Selly Rotich broke in tears on May 11 as she narrated how her only son has been subjecting her family to torture and abuse.

According to Selly, the son, Nelson Kiptoo Limo who is 33, has been beating her and her husband. He has forcing his 60-year-old father to flee the home on several occasions to avoid the beatings.

Selly told the court that her son was previously jailed, but he did not reform even after his release from a two year sentence.

“Jail my son. I beg this court not to release this boy, my life is in danger due to frequent threats and attack from the accused. I desire the accused to remain in jail until our deaths for us to enjoy peace. If he is released before our deaths, he is going to kill us,” Selly begged the court.

The court also heard that on April 23, at Lemok village in Kapseret sub-county of Uasin Gishu County, Selly’s son had threatened to kill her and any witnesses to the killing.

“I have heard your concerns as a parent and this court cannot make a decision to deny the accused bond before receiving a probation report,” the magistrate ruled.
